You go girl. I've lightish brown hair, fair complexion and hazel eyes. I've tried it and it looks great. Another alternative is to mix some burgandy in as well to give it depth. In this way you can try it without it being to big of a shock for you.



Another thing I've done is to go a darker brown and have an ash blond piece come from underneath - just one thick piece. It gets you noticed but you can hide it if you want to.

When clients tell me they want caramel highlights I show them Jennifer Lopez's hair. She has the epitome of caramel highlights. If you have light brown hair how light is light? Level 1 is black Level 2-3 is a very dark brown almost black, Level 4-5 is a dark brown, level 6-7 is a lighter brown depending on the colour product used in Goldwell a level 6 is a great milk chocolate colour. To me this is the perfect base for the caramel highlights. If it is a lighter shade of brown than this then realistically it is closer to a dark blonde. this Can also look good with caramel highlights but then I suggest some lighter streaks of blonde as well. Difficult to give an accurate accessment without seeing the hair. Best bet is to find a variety of different pics of Jennifer Lopez and Jessica Alba and take them to a professional colour specialist. Don't recommend trying this look at home as it may turn to brassy. Highlights underneath would look smashing but make sure the cut you have is going to showcase it otherwise you won't get the desired effect your looking for. Hope this helps.
